Configuration setting
If there is no other busbar via the busbar loops that are possible, then either the interlocking
for the 152 open circuit breaker is not used or the state for BBTR is set to open. That is,
no busbar transfer is in progress in this bus-section:
•
BBTR_OP = 1
•
VP_BBTR = 1
